Riepilogo:This article engages the genesis of Raymund Schwager's theological thinking in the context of the Cold War. It is argued that his development of a very specific dogmatic theology with its focus on processes of exclusion and victimization can only be understood adequately, if this pressing sign of the time of the late 20th century is taken into account. Schwager's theology cannot be separated from his commitment to the peace movement. In this context, the importance of the hypotheses of cultural theorist Rene Girard and the notion of the fides Christi for developing his model of a Dramatic model of soteriology are described. Thus, Dramatic Theology is put in a surprisingly new light.
